Save

User ShortByte uploaded this Easter Chicken Ducklings Easter Day Happy Easter PNG PNG image on February 11, 2023, 6:05 am. The resolution of this file is 3000x2377px and its file size is: 971.33 KB. This PNG image is filed under the tags: